Tony Randall Pollard is a running back who is currently on the roster of the Dallas Cowboys of the National Football League. He was born on April 30, 1997.

He played college football for Memphis before being selected by the Cowboys in the fourth round of the 2019 NFL Draft. While a student at Melrose High School, Pollard participated in high school football. As a senior, he made his high school football team as a cornerback and wide receiver.

He accumulated more than 1,200 receiving yards, scored 20 touchdowns, and was selected All-District 16-AAA, all of which helped the club qualify for the playoffs. Pollard accepted a football scholarship from the University of Memphis.

As a redshirt freshman, he participated in 13 games, starting seven of them. At 128 overall and in the fourth round of the 2019 NFL Draft, the Dallas Cowboys selected Pollard.

He carried the ball 13 times for 24 yards in his NFL debut against the New York Giants in Week 1, helping the squad to a 35-17 victory.
